The Importance of Expense Management Software in Spanish

Expense management software in Spanish is crucial for businesses operating in Spanish-speaking regions, helping streamline expense tracking and ensure compliance with local regulations. With 88% of SMEs in Spain recognizing the importance of digital tools for productivity, the demand for such software is on the rise. Businesses are transitioning from outdated manual processes to digital solutions that offer automated tracking, thereby enhancing productivity by up to 84% and saving finance teams 75% in processing time.

Companies are increasingly focusing on robust expense management solutions to reduce reliance on cash advances and implement stricter budgets. This shift is evident in SMEs, where 250 to 499 employee firms are drastically cutting down on manual expense processes. How Harvest Simplifies Expense Tracking for Spanish-Speaking Users

Harvest provides a straightforward solution for expense management, ideal for small to medium-sized businesses seeking a simple way to track project-related expenses. While it does not offer AI-driven receipt scanning or integration with Microsoft Business Central, Harvest allows users to upload receipts and manually enter details, ensuring that expenses are accurately recorded and tracked.

For businesses needing to manage expenses without the complexity of automated workflows, Harvest’s project-based system is a practical choice. It allows companies to add tax information like VAT numbers to invoices, though it does not automate compliance with local Spanish tax standards. This makes it a suitable option for businesses looking to maintain control over their financial records while ensuring they meet basic tax requirements.
